Series V3 Vortex FlowmeterThe operation of the Universal vortex flow meter is based on the vortex shedding principle. As fluid moves around a body, vortices (eddies) are formed and move downstream. They form alternately, from one side to the other, causing pressure fluctuations. These are sensed by a piezoelectric crystal in the sensor tube, and are converted to a 4-20 mA or pulse signal. |

DFS-22 & DFS-23 & DFS-24 Teflon¨ Flow Transmitter The DFS-20 Series Teflon® flow meters provide flow sensing capabilities in a wide variety of OEM and end-use applications including corrosive aqueous liquids. The fluid flows though the meter, passing a fixed worm that imparts a spiral flow that, in turn, spins the rotor on a virtually friction free bearing. The rotor blades reflect an infrared beam that generates a high resolution digital output signal. |

New Inert Solenoid Valve Excellent For Automated Chemistry ApplicationsHudson, MAClark is pleased to introduce its Model PKV-2R Molded Inert Isolation Valves. These two-way, solenoid operated valves are molded of PPS and feature a PTFE isolation diaphragm and FPM valve seat seal. FPM valve seat seals are extremely tolerant of particulates in media, which enhances valve performance and service life. PKV-2R Valves have a 6 mm orifice size and are excellent for controlling waste fluid lines on automated chemistry systems such as analytical, clinical, and biotechnology analyzers. They are also well suited to other high purity applications in semiconductor, pharmaceutical, and medical device manufacturing. |
